概括
抗生素管理计划已经在医疗保健机构显著扩大. 本综述涵盖了对抗生素使用的基础设施,法规和结果测量的关键发展.

Development of Antibiotic Resistance
40
Antibiotic resistance is a major public health concern that arises when bacteria evolve mechanisms to withstand the effects of antibiotic treatments. This resistance can be intrinsic, acquired through genetic mutations, or transferred between bacteria via horizontal gene transfer.
